Ta'ovala Maths Challenge
L.I to find the most eficient stratergy
For this challenge we solved a question regarding ta'ovala. Ta'ovala is a traditional Tongan piece of clothing worn for special occasions. Our main information was that for 8 ta'ovala 12 meters of material was used, we need to find out how many meters of material would take to make 26 ta'ovala. First we found out how much material it would take to make one ta'ovala which we did by dividing 12 by 2, 6 by 2 and then 3 by 2 which gave us 1.5. After that we multiplied 1.5 x 10 two times which gave us 30, then we multiplied 1.5 x 6 and that gave us 9. Lastly we added 30 and 9 to give us our answer 39.

Then & Now
This week for cybersmart we worked collaboratively to discover new things about a gourd. We started on by using what a gourd and what it was used for. We found out that it was used to storage fresh water to keep hydrated. We also found out that a gourd is a type of fruit which is related to the cucurbit family, which includes melon, cucumber and squash.
